aboutsummaryrefslogtreecommitdiff
path: root/requirements
diff options
context:
space:
mode:
authorDavid Lord <davidism@gmail.com>2020-05-18 15:10:00 -0700
committerDavid Lord <davidism@gmail.com>2020-05-18 15:25:33 -0700
commit24cc61df5f3b6b42598c317ebe60ac84dc498e65 (patch)
tree168e5c3fcb3171d6543db2d0e4c658cdfaa90264 /requirements
parent4e7befbf646db22d61d9436378079f1468a02ebe (diff)
downloadjinja-24cc61df5f3b6b42598c317ebe60ac84dc498e65.tar.gz
use pip-compile to pin dev requirements
Diffstat (limited to 'requirements')
-rw-r--r--requirements/dev.in6
-rw-r--r--requirements/dev.txt55
-rw-r--r--requirements/docs.in4
-rw-r--r--requirements/docs.txt36
-rw-r--r--requirements/tests.in1
-rw-r--r--requirements/tests.txt15
6 files changed, 117 insertions, 0 deletions
diff --git a/requirements/dev.in b/requirements/dev.in
new file mode 100644
index 00000000..3937d2dd
--- /dev/null
+++ b/requirements/dev.in
@@ -0,0 +1,6 @@
+-e file:.
+-r docs.in
+-r tests.in
+pip-tools
+pre-commit
+tox
diff --git a/requirements/dev.txt b/requirements/dev.txt
new file mode 100644
index 00000000..b1c54e60
--- /dev/null
+++ b/requirements/dev.txt
@@ -0,0 +1,55 @@
+#
+# This file is autogenerated by pip-compile
+# To update, run:
+#
+# pip-compile requirements/dev.in
+#
+-e file:. # via -r requirements/dev.in, sphinx
+alabaster==0.7.12 # via sphinx
+appdirs==1.4.4 # via virtualenv
+attrs==19.3.0 # via pytest
+babel==2.8.0 # via sphinx
+certifi==2020.4.5.1 # via requests
+cfgv==3.1.0 # via pre-commit
+chardet==3.0.4 # via requests
+click==7.1.2 # via pip-tools
+distlib==0.3.0 # via virtualenv
+docutils==0.16 # via sphinx
+filelock==3.0.12 # via tox, virtualenv
+identify==1.4.15 # via pre-commit
+idna==2.9 # via requests
+imagesize==1.2.0 # via sphinx
+more-itertools==8.3.0 # via pytest
+nodeenv==1.3.5 # via pre-commit
+packaging==20.3 # via pallets-sphinx-themes, pytest, sphinx, tox
+pallets-sphinx-themes==1.2.3 # via -r requirements/docs.in
+pip-tools==5.1.2 # via -r requirements/dev.in
+pluggy==0.13.1 # via pytest, tox
+pre-commit==2.4.0 # via -r requirements/dev.in
+py==1.8.1 # via pytest, tox
+pygments==2.6.1 # via sphinx
+pyparsing==2.4.7 # via packaging
+pytest==5.4.2 # via -r requirements/tests.in
+pytz==2020.1 # via babel
+pyyaml==5.3.1 # via pre-commit
+requests==2.23.0 # via sphinx
+six==1.14.0 # via packaging, pip-tools, tox, virtualenv
+snowballstemmer==2.0.0 # via sphinx
+sphinx-issues==1.2.0 # via -r requirements/docs.in
+sphinx==2.4.4 # via -r requirements/docs.in, pallets-sphinx-themes, sphinx-issues, sphinxcontrib-log-cabinet
+sphinxcontrib-applehelp==1.0.2 # via sphinx
+sphinxcontrib-devhelp==1.0.2 # via sphinx
+sphinxcontrib-htmlhelp==1.0.3 # via sphinx
+sphinxcontrib-jsmath==1.0.1 # via sphinx
+sphinxcontrib-log-cabinet==1.0.1 # via -r requirements/docs.in
+sphinxcontrib-qthelp==1.0.3 # via sphinx
+sphinxcontrib-serializinghtml==1.1.4 # via sphinx
+toml==0.10.1 # via pre-commit, tox
+tox==3.15.0 # via -r requirements/dev.in
+urllib3==1.25.9 # via requests
+virtualenv==20.0.20 # via pre-commit, tox
+wcwidth==0.1.9 # via pytest
+
+# The following packages are considered to be unsafe in a requirements file:
+# pip
+# setuptools
diff --git a/requirements/docs.in b/requirements/docs.in
new file mode 100644
index 00000000..42f16511
--- /dev/null
+++ b/requirements/docs.in
@@ -0,0 +1,4 @@
+Pallets-Sphinx-Themes
+Sphinx<3
+sphinx-issues
+sphinxcontrib-log-cabinet
diff --git a/requirements/docs.txt b/requirements/docs.txt
new file mode 100644
index 00000000..14a5ad6d
--- /dev/null
+++ b/requirements/docs.txt
@@ -0,0 +1,36 @@
+#
+# This file is autogenerated by pip-compile
+# To update, run:
+#
+# pip-compile requirements/docs.in
+#
+alabaster==0.7.12 # via sphinx
+babel==2.8.0 # via sphinx
+certifi==2020.4.5.1 # via requests
+chardet==3.0.4 # via requests
+docutils==0.16 # via sphinx
+idna==2.9 # via requests
+imagesize==1.2.0 # via sphinx
+jinja2==2.11.2 # via sphinx
+markupsafe==1.1.1 # via jinja2
+packaging==20.3 # via pallets-sphinx-themes, sphinx
+pallets-sphinx-themes==1.2.3 # via -r requirements/docs.in
+pygments==2.6.1 # via sphinx
+pyparsing==2.4.7 # via packaging
+pytz==2020.1 # via babel
+requests==2.23.0 # via sphinx
+six==1.14.0 # via packaging
+snowballstemmer==2.0.0 # via sphinx
+sphinx-issues==1.2.0 # via -r requirements/docs.in
+sphinx==2.4.4 # via -r requirements/docs.in, pallets-sphinx-themes, sphinx-issues, sphinxcontrib-log-cabinet
+sphinxcontrib-applehelp==1.0.2 # via sphinx
+sphinxcontrib-devhelp==1.0.2 # via sphinx
+sphinxcontrib-htmlhelp==1.0.3 # via sphinx
+sphinxcontrib-jsmath==1.0.1 # via sphinx
+sphinxcontrib-log-cabinet==1.0.1 # via -r requirements/docs.in
+sphinxcontrib-qthelp==1.0.3 # via sphinx
+sphinxcontrib-serializinghtml==1.1.4 # via sphinx
+urllib3==1.25.9 # via requests
+
+# The following packages are considered to be unsafe in a requirements file:
+# setuptools
diff --git a/requirements/tests.in b/requirements/tests.in
new file mode 100644
index 00000000..e079f8a6
--- /dev/null
+++ b/requirements/tests.in
@@ -0,0 +1 @@
+pytest
diff --git a/requirements/tests.txt b/requirements/tests.txt
new file mode 100644
index 00000000..aa2bfaf6
--- /dev/null
+++ b/requirements/tests.txt
@@ -0,0 +1,15 @@
+#
+# This file is autogenerated by pip-compile
+# To update, run:
+#
+# pip-compile requirements/tests.in
+#
+attrs==19.3.0 # via pytest
+more-itertools==8.3.0 # via pytest
+packaging==20.3 # via pytest
+pluggy==0.13.1 # via pytest
+py==1.8.1 # via pytest
+pyparsing==2.4.7 # via packaging
+pytest==5.4.2 # via -r requirements/tests.in
+six==1.14.0 # via packaging
+wcwidth==0.1.9 # via pytest